About B Scazziga

B Scazziga is a scholar working on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ism, Surgery, Molecular Biology, Pathology and Forensic Medicine and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, having authored 20 papers that have together received 512 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Thyroid Disorders and Treatments (6 papers), Thyroid Cancer Diagnosis and Treatment (5 papers), Mitochondrial Function and Pathology (3 papers), Metabolism, Diabetes, and Cancer (2 papers), Thyroid and Parathyroid Surgery (2 papers), Pituitary Gland Disorders and Treatments (2 papers), Intestinal Malrotation and Obstruction Disorders (1 paper) and Metabolism and Genetic Disorders (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ism (237 citations),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ging (202 citations), Oncology (117 citations), Medical Terminology (1 citation) and Pathology and Forensic Medicine (48 citations). B Scazziga has collaborated with scholars based in Switzerland and Italy. Frequent co-authors include J.-P. Mach, Magali Schreyer, F. Buchegger, S Carrel, Charles M. Haskell, T Lemarchand-Béraud, D Gardiol, J. Hürlimann, Eric Jéquier and Jean‐Pierre Felber. Their work appears in journals such as European Journal of Endocrinology, American Journal of Nephrology, Cancer, Histopathology and The Journal of Experimental Medicine.
